My period is a few days late, well was a few days late, it came on yesterday morning but I bled for next to no time and barely left a mark on the tampon and the same happened again today. My first thought was because I was a under the weather (really tiered feeling run down and sick) last week that its thrown my cycle off, but after a few google searches and realization that it was just over 3 weeks ago that I had unprotected sex I'm now starting to question and panic. Is there any possibility that I could be pregnant or could it just be because I was ill.

Hi Becky,
It would be worth you taking a pregnancy test if you do not have a 'proper' period in the next few days. When you conceive you can get something called implantation bleeding which is usually a bit of spotting and could be what you have experienced. Only you know your body but take a test or go to the Dr to set your mind at ease. x
Hi there
If you are worried then a pregnancy test would be accurate as it is 3 weeks since the last unprotected sex. Illness can affect periods, and if you are on oral contraceptive pills, vomiting can make the pill less effective.
I hope this helps
